SH2-mediated steric occlusion of the C2 domain regulates autoinhibition of SHIP1 inositol 5-phosphatase

2025-09-02

Abstract excerpt

The Src homology 2 (SH2) domain containing inositol polyphosphate 5-phosphatase 1 (SHIP1) is an immune cell specific enzyme that regulates phosphatidylinositol-(3,4,5)-trisphosphate signaling at the plasma membrane following receptor activation. SHIP1 plays an important role in processes such as directed cell migration, endocytosis, and cortical membrane oscillations. Alterations in SHIP1 expression have been show...
